Job Summary

This role is for a Telecommunications Security Expert (Electrical Engineer) primarily based in Saarbrücken, Germany, within the "Security in Telecommunications" department. The successful candidate will be responsible for defining and evolving security requirements for telecommunication companies, assessing the implementation of protective measures, and coordinating company audits. A key part of the role involves evaluating new technologies against telecommunications law, applying and analyzing relevant norms and regulations in mobile and wired communication, and collaborating with national and international ministries and authorities. This position offers a unique opportunity to contribute to the resilience of critical telecommunications infrastructure and shape future regulatory frameworks, ensuring robust consumer protection and sustainable competition in Germany's digital landscape.
